{"repo":"wenqi9115-glitch/systematic-etf-relative-strength-alpha-attribution","free":true,"listed":false,"github":"https://github.com/wenqi9115-glitch/systematic-etf-relative-strength-alpha-attribution","clone":"git clone https://github.com/wenqi9115-glitch/systematic-etf-relative-strength-alpha-attribution.git","description":"Systematic ETF relative-strength research, overlapping-sleeve portfolio construction, LEAN implementation, and factor attribution.","language":"Jupyter Notebook","stars":104,"topics":["algorithmic-trading","factor-models","portfolio-construction","python","quantconnect","quantitative-finance"],"license":"MIT","category":"trading","readme_excerpt":"Systematic ETF Relative-Strength Strategy & Alpha Attribution I built this project to answer a fairly narrow question: can a simple relative-strength rule rotate among liquid commodity and industry ETFs, and how much of the resulting return is actually unexplained alpha? The backtest looked attractive at first. The attribution work changed the conclusion. Standard Fama-French controls left a positive intercept, but adding direct proxies for the exposures the strategy was trading raised model R² from 14.0% to 63.6% and reduced the annualized intercept from 16.5% to 0.38%. My final interpretation is therefore a rules-based way to manage commodity and industry exposure, not evidence of persistent standalone alpha. Strategy The candidate set is GLD , SLV , USO , SMH , and XBI ; SPY is used only as the comparator. For ETF \\(i\\) on date \\(t\\), the signal is its 20-session adjusted return less the corresponding SPY return: $$ RS {i,t}^{20}=\\left(\\frac{P {i,t}}{P {i,t-20}}-1\\right)-\\left(\\frac{P {SPY,t}}{P {SPY,t-20}}-1\\right). $$ At each rebalance, the two highest finite signals receive 2.5% sleeves. Each sleeve remains active for ten trading sessions, so repeated selections accumulate: $$ w {i,t}=0.025\\sum {k=0}^{9}\\mathbf{1}\\{i\\text{ was selected at }t-k\\}. $$ This construction makes the portfolio limits easy to audit. Ten active sleeves cap a single ETF at 25%; two selections per day cap total gross exposure at 50%. The parameters are fixed in configs/strategy config.json .
